Suniti N Nimbkar, MD

Locations
Dr. Suniti Nimbkar, Medical Director of the Breast Care Center at Dana-Farber Brigham Cancer Center at South Shore Health
I'm a surgical oncologist, and the Medical Director of the Breast Care Center at Dana-Farber Brigham Cancer Center at South Shore Health and an Instructor in Surgery at Harvard Medical School. I received my Doctor of Medicine degree from Boston University School of Medicine and completed my General Surgery residency at Boston University Medical Center.
My mission is to provide outstanding, compassionate care for patients with breast cancer which integrates multi-disciplinary care and allows for the most up to date treatment standards.
I went into the field of breast surgery because I knew that I wanted to be able to help patients going through a new diagnosis of breast cancer with thoughtfulness and insight into the latest therapeutic options. I feel that being a part of the team at the DFBWCC Cancer Center in clinical affiliation with South Shore Health allows me to be a part of a team of superbly talented clinicians who all have the same goals in mind when it comes to the care of a patient with breast cancer – personalized care, compassion, mutual respect and attention to details.
